Arsenal suffer fresh injury blow for Athletic clash

Arsenal have suffered a big injury blow ahead of the Champions League opener against Athletic Bilbao on the road.
The Gunners returned to winning ways with a 3-0 win over Nottingham Forest in the Premier League on Saturday afternoon.
In the same game, Martin Odegaard suffered a shoulder injury similar to the one against Leeds United earlier last month.
Odegaard could not carry on and was substituted early in the first half.
The Norwegian has now not travelled with the team to the Basque Country and won't be involved in the Champions League curtain-raiser.
In his absence, Ethan Nwaneri has been playing in the number 10 role, but we won't be surprised if Eberechi Eze gets the nod there.
Gabriel Martinelli could return on the left wing for the Gunners and Eze could be asked to play from his prefered attacking role.
Arsenal are huge favourites to reach the last 16 of the competition. They should pick up a comfortable win over Athletic tomorrow.
